Process of Shrimp Hatchery:
1. Selection of Parent Shrimp: The first step in shrimp hatchery is selecting healthy parent shrimp with good genetic traits. This is crucial for ensuring the quality of the shrimp stock.
2. Egg Collection: Once the parent shrimp are selected, the eggs are collected and transferred to the hatchery for incubation.
3. Incubation: The eggs are incubated in controlled conditions, ensuring optimal temperature, pH, and oxygen levels. This process usually takes about 24-48 hours.
4. Hatching: After incubation, the eggs hatch into larvae. The larvae are then transferred to the nursery tanks for further growth.
5. Nursery Rearing: The larvae are nurtured in the nursery tanks for about 2-3 weeks. During this period, they are fed a special diet and monitored for any signs of disease or stress.
6. Stocking: Once the larvae reach the desired size, they are transferred to the grow-out ponds for further growth and maturation.
Best Practices in Shrimp Hatchery:
1. Biosecurity: Implement strict biosecurity measures to prevent the introduction of diseases and pests.
2. Water Quality Management: Maintain optimal water quality parameters, such as temperature, pH, and dissolved oxygen levels, to ensure the health and growth of the shrimp.
3. Nutrition: Provide a balanced diet to the shrimp larvae and post-larvae, ensuring they receive all the necessary nutrients for healthy growth.
4. Monitoring and Record Keeping: Regularly monitor the shrimp population and maintain detailed records of growth, feeding, and any health issues.
5. Training and Expertise: Invest in training and hiring skilled personnel to manage the shrimp hatchery effectively.
